Kloefkorn Elementary is currently home to approximately 500 students. We are organized into grade-level instructional teams: preschool through fifth grade. Our specialists (art, music, physical education, technology) collaborate with classroom teachers as they plan and implement instruction. We also partner with Family Service, which offers before and after school childcare.

We are very fortunate to have strong parent leaders who serve on our active PTO, which focuses their efforts on improving and increasing learning opportunities for Kloefkorn students (Pre-K-5th grade).
